Introduction to Florida’s Unseasonable Cold Snap

On January 30, 2024, South Florida was caught off guard by an unseasonable cold snap, associated with an unusual Arctic blast that sent temperatures plummeting to record lows. Miami, a city renowned for its mild winter climate, registered a shocking 35°F, marking the coldest temperature recorded in the area since 1989. This drastic change has necessitated a rapid response from city officials and has impacted various sectors within the community.

The Impact of the Cold Front on Daily Life

The polar vortex, which swept through the southeastern United States, has disrupted daily life in Miami and surrounding regions. In light of the frigid temperatures, schools within Miami-Dade County postponed openings to prioritize the safety of students and staff. The city also set up emergency warming shelters to provide refuge for the unhoused population and those lacking sufficient heating at home. These proactive measures highlight the urgency and seriousness with which local authorities are addressing the situation.

Agricultural Challenges Facing Local Farmers

Adverse weather conditions brought on by the unexpected cold snap have had a profound effect on local agriculture, specifically affecting citrus and avocado growers. Many farmers reported significant damage to their crops, prompting urgent responses to mitigate further destruction through freeze-prevention measures. The Florida Department of Agriculture has initiated plans to evaluate the extent of the agricultural losses, considering relief programs to support the farmers affected by this dire situation.

Transportation Disruptions and Safety Concerns

The impact of the cold weather extended to transportation networks, where black ice formed on bridges and overpasses, resulting in multiple accidents and creating traffic congestion on major highways. Miami International Airport also faced delays, as rare de-icing procedures were implemented on departing flights—a sight that residents were unaccustomed to witnessing in a location known for its warm climate. These traffic disruptions underscore the widespread effects of the unexpected winter weather.
